The following bills did not make it out of committee in time for further consideration. These bills are considered “dead” for the session.

HB 1003 included preschools and school bus stops in the buffer distance requirements of state-licensed marijuana businesses.

HB 1131 and SB 5155 would have legalized recreational home grow.

SB 5599 required the Liquor and Cannabis Board to issue a retail cannabis license to a municipal corporation, commission, or authority.

HB 1358 would have allowed cannabis retail delivery.
